In the story books, a hero gets their time in the spotlight. They are thrown parades, showered with prestige, and adored by all. Samuel Gale, Hero of Cortendale and Guardian of the Wind thought he would gain such notoriety when entering his kingdom's capitol. What he got was hand irons and a dose of reality. Real paragons of the people warrant suspicion from those in power, altruistic ideals are questioned, and he finds that the world cannot be changed on goodwill alone. Sam is about to enter a place that is altogether foreign inside the walls of this city. Problems aren't so clear here, enemies not as overt. Will Sam's ideals be able to survive his time in such a morally ambiguous place? He must take care not to drown while visiting the city in the center of a sea...
